Abstract
One of the major concerns of High-strength concrete is its fire resistance. In some of our earlier high-rise RC projects, the most straight-forward measurewas taken to avoid the fire concerns : to provide additional finishing with normal-strength mortar layers all over the column surface. On the other hand, it has been known that the inclusion of polypropylene fibers improves the fire resistance of high-strength concrete by creating a pore structure that enables steam to dissipate. In this report, workability, compressive strength, durability, and fire resistance of the fiber concrete are summarized, and the application of such a concrete to an actual building construction is introduced.
